A 71-year-old bed-ridden patient made a miraculous recovery and embraced a new life recently after suffering from irregular heartbeats. The man experienced something called 'bradycardia', which doctors state is a type of abnormal heart rhythm (arrhythmia) where the heart beats slower than 60 beats per minute. People who experience irregular heartbeats often face serious health problems and require a pacemaker to regulate their heart rate.
The septuagenarian's case was a remarkable medical breakthrough that allowed him to receive a life-saving treatment at Medicover Hospital in Navi Mumbai, under a team of doctors led by Dr Keshav Kale, senior interventional cardiologist. They managed to successfully implant a 'medtronic micra dual leadless pacemaker' without the need for surgery or incisions. The procedure is being called 'revolutionary', having been performed for the first time at the hospital. It managed to stabilise the patient's heartbeat, ultimately saving his life. The man has now recovered fully and resumed his daily routine.

Great Western Hospital is currently extremely busy, with some patients having to wait much longer than we would like for urgent or emergency care.
We also have a number of patients waiting for a bed to become available so they can be admitted for ongoing care. If you have a loved one who is ready to leave hospital, please help us by collecting them promptly and getting the home ready for their return.
We prioritise people in order of clinical need so, if you're waiting, this is while we treat those in a serious or more life-threatening condition.
Contact NHS 111 in the first instance before coming to hospital if you're not sure what to do.
